Ch Llacue's Mozart
Update August 1999!!
My Mozart, Llacue's Mozart has finished his Championship, at the Astroworld series of Dog Shows in Houston, July 22nd-25th. He finished with WD and BOW for a Major.....his third Major! He took these wins at the Galveston Kennel Club under judge Mrs. Patricia A. Murphy of Chicago Illinois. We are hysterically happy! He is my first Champion!Mozart's win at the Astrodome!
After being on vacation from showing for two months, he won WD on Feb 21st under Judge Doug Shipley, at the Brazoria Kennel club all breed show, see photo above. The following day at Cypress Kennel Club under Mr. Chris Neale Mozart got RWD for a major.
Introducing Llacue's Mozart soon at a showsite near you!! This fine boy is ready and willing to go, and go he does!! His movement is spectacular, his temperament perfect and his body is extremely well put together and balanced.He is true coming and going, has a beautiful topline, level bite, lovely coat and has a charming character!!. We are very proud of this big boy as he is only 14 months old and already has 7 points including a major..
We started showing him at the Houston Speciality at the Astrodome where he won his class and RWD (photo above) under Dr Barry Deitch. The following day he won his class again. Then the last day at the Galveston Kennel Club he won his class and RWD again!! Not bad for our first weekend out with him.
He has travelled around a bit to some shows and almost always wins his class. Now that he has gotten a couple of months older he is really turning heads. At the last three dog shows, he won WD and BOS at the Baytown Kennel Club in Crosby under Rhoda Winter Russell in October. In November he won WD for a major at Ford Bend Kennel Club under Judge Kenneth Henrichsen (photo left, above). The following day he won WD again under Patricia Trotter (photo right, above) We look forward to his ongoing and rapidly moving show career.
This litter is sired by Ch Llacue's El Goya (Red Cloud son) out of Llacue's La Belle Christine, the pedigree is shown at the bottom of this page.
